Myths About LASIK Pain



As opposed to popular belief, LASIK surgical procedure isn't as excruciating as many individuals believe. The treatment itself is reasonably quick and pain-free. You might really feel some stress or pain throughout the surgical treatment, but it's commonly very little. The surgeon will certainly utilize numbing eye drops to ensure that you don't really feel any type of pain throughout the procedure.



While it's typical to experience some dryness, itching, or light discomfort in the hours following the surgical procedure, this can normally be taken care of with over-the-counter discomfort medication and eye decreases. It is necessary to follow your physician's post-operative treatment directions to reduce any type of discomfort and promote correct recovery.

Remember that everybody's discomfort tolerance is various, so what a single person might call awkward might be entirely tolerable for one more. Feel confident that LASIK discomfort is typically not a major issue and should not discourage you from considering this life-changing treatment.

Risks Associated With LASIK



Many people going through LASIK surgical treatment are largely worried concerning potential dangers associated with the treatment. While try this website is a secure and efficient treatment for vision Correction, like any kind of operation, it does include some risks.

The most common risks connected with LASIK include dry eyes, glare, halos, and trouble driving at night in the instant postoperative period. These signs are typically temporary and improve as the eyes heal.

In rare situations, more significant issues such as infection, corneal flap problems, and vision loss can take place, however the possibility of these complications is incredibly low when the surgical treatment is executed by an experienced and knowledgeable eye doctor. It is necessary to go over these risks with your physician throughout the appointment to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to anticipate.

Eligibility Misconceptions



Some individuals erroneously believe that just people with severe vision problems are qualified for LASIK surgical treatment. Nevertheless, this is an usual misunderstanding. While LASIK is frequently associated with dealing with high levels of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, individuals with milder vision concerns can additionally be qualified candidates. In fact, innovations in LASIK innovation have actually broadened the variety of treatable prescriptions, permitting more people to take advantage of the treatment.

LASIK qualification is determined with a detailed eye assessment by a qualified ophthalmologist. Aspects such as corneal density, eye health and wellness, and general medical history play an important function in assessing a patient's viability for the surgery.

Also individuals over 40, that might have presbyopia (age-related difficulty concentrating on close items), can potentially undertake LASIK or various other vision Correction procedures.

It is essential not to self-diagnose your eligibility for LASIK surgical procedure. Consulting with a skilled eye treatment specialist is the very best method to figure out if you're an ideal prospect for this life-altering procedure.
